Symptoms

Assume that you configure a quorum model to Node Majority and to File Share Witness resource on a Windows Server 2008 R2-based Cluster service. In this situation, you receive Event IDs 1558 and 1069 in the system event log every 15 minutes. For example, you receive the following event logs:


The issue occurs when the following registry key for Restart Policy is set to 1 on all nodes:H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Cluster\Quorum\WitnessFailed
Note The issue is not resolved when you set the registry key to 0.

Cause

This issue occurs because the Cluster service uses a restart policy to monitor and recover from failures of the Witness resource. When a failure occurs, the Restart Policy tries to restart the Witness resource after a 15 minutes time interval. However, if the Witness resource is not storage capable, the Cluster service cannot set the restart policy to a success state after the Witness resource is restarted. Therefore, the failure occurs again after 15 minutes and keeps repeating every 15 minutes.

Note By default, the restart policy is configured to restart the Witness resource every 15 minutes. You can reconfigure the time interval by using the WitnessRestartInterval cluster property.   • GDR service branches contain only those fixes that are widely released to address widespread, critical issues. LDR service branches contain hotfixes in addition to widely released fixes.

Workaround

To work around this issue, use one of the following methods:

  • Perform a reform on cluster nodes to clear the failed status in the restart policy object. 
    Note A reform occurs when all the nodes are shut down or all cluster service on every node are shut down at the same time.

  • Switch the quorum model to the storage capable quorum model temporarily. After the issue is resolved, you can switch the quorum model back to the original quorum model.

Note After you work around the issue by using one of earlier methods, the issue might reoccur.
